아하
검색 이미지
전기·전자 이미지
전기·전자학문
전기·전자 이미지
전기·전자학문
잘난말벌12
잘난말벌1223.03.31

이클립스에서 파일 수정을 하고 실행을 해도 반영이 안 됩니다.

이클립스에서 학습용으로 index.html 파일을 만들고 톰캣서버로 연동해서 연습 좀 하고 있는데요.

앳지 브라우저로 실행을 해 보면 반영이 안 됩니다.

도대체 뭐가 문제일까요?

문제를 해결해 보려고 해도 특별히 할게 없어요.

오류면 열심히 책을 찾아보고 연구해 보겠지만...

그냥 반영이 안 됩니다.

뭐가 문제일까요?

55글자 더 채워주세요.
답변의 개수
3개의 답변이 있어요!
  • 탈퇴한 사용자
    탈퇴한 사용자23.03.31

    안녕하세요. 김경욱 과학전문가입니다.

    이 경우, 문제의 원인은 여러 가지일 수 있습니다. 하지만 가장 일반적인 원인은 캐시 문제입니다. 캐시는 브라우저에서 이전에 열어본 웹 페이지의 데이터를 저장해 놓는 곳으로, 같은 페이지를 두 번째 이상 방문할 때 빠르게 로딩할 수 있도록 도와줍니다. 때문에, 새로 만든 index.html 파일이 브라우저의 캐시에 저장되어 있는 이전 파일과 충돌하여 반영이 되지 않을 수 있습니다.

    해결 방법으로는 브라우저의 캐시를 삭제하는 것입니다. 일반적으로는 브라우저 설정에서 캐시를 삭제할 수 있으며, 브라우저마다 방법이 다를 수 있습니다. 예를 들어, 크롬 브라우저에서는 설정 메뉴에서 "개인정보 및 보안" -> "캐시 및 쿠키" -> "이미지 및 파일이 저장된 캐시"를 선택하고, "데이터 삭제" 버튼을 클릭하여 캐시를 삭제할 수 있습니다.

    또한, 파일의 경로나 서버 설정 문제도 원인이 될 수 있으므로, 이 부분도 한번 체크해보시는 것이 좋습니다.

    만족스러운 답변이었나요?간단한 별점을 통해 의견을 알려주세요.

  • 안녕하세요. 김경태 과학전문가입니다.

    index.html 파일을 수정하고 저장하였음에도 불구하고, 브라우저에서 반영되지 않는다면 캐시(Cache) 문제가 일어난 것일 수 있습니다. 브라우저는 이전에 방문한 웹사이트의 일부 데이터를 캐시에 저장하여, 다음에 방문할 때 더 빠르게 로딩할 수 있도록 합니다.

    이를 해결하기 위해서는 브라우저 캐시를 삭제해야 합니다. 캐시를 삭제하는 방법은 브라우저마다 조금씩 다르기 때문에 사용 중인 브라우저에 따라 검색하여 찾아보시면 됩니다. 예를 들면, Chrome에서는 Ctrl + Shift + Delete를 누르면 캐시 삭제 창이 나타나며, 이 중에서 "이미지 및 파일 캐시" 항목을 선택하여 캐시를 삭제할 수 있습니다.

    또한, 톰캣 서버를 재시작하여도 캐시 문제가 해결되지 않을 수 있습니다. 이 경우에는 브라우저 캐시를 삭제한 후, 다시 톰캣 서버를 재시작하여 문제를 해결할 수 있습니다.

    만족스러운 답변이었나요?간단한 별점을 통해 의견을 알려주세요.

  • 안녕하세요. 이종민 과학전문가입니다.

    해당 문제는 여러 가지 원인이 있을 수 있습니다. 몇 가지 가능한 원인들과 그에 대한 대처 방법을 아래에 안내해 드리겠습니다.

    1. 파일 이름이나 경로가 잘못되었을 경우

    • index.html 파일 이름이나 경로를 다시 한번 확인해 보세요. 파일이름이나 경로가 잘못되었다면 해당 파일이 서버에 제대로 올라가지 않아서 반영이 안 될 수 있습니다.

    1. 캐시 문제일 경우

    • 브라우저에서 이전에 한번 접속했을 때 파일을 캐싱해서 다시 불러오지 않는 경우가 있을 수 있습니다. 이 경우, 캐시를 지우고 브라우저를 재시작하거나 브라우저 설정에서 캐시 사용을 끄는 것을 시도해 보세요.

    1. 서버 설정이나 구성 문제일 경우

    • 톰캣 서버 설정이나 구성 문제로 인해 파일이 정상적으로 서비스되지 않을 수 있습니다. 이 경우, 톰캣 로그를 확인해 보시거나 서버 설정을 다시 한번 확인해 보세요.

    1. 파일 내용이 문제일 경우

    • 파일 내용에 문제가 있어서 정상적으로 표시되지 않을 수 있습니다. 이 경우, 파일을 다시 작성하거나 수정해 보세요.

    위의 원인들 중 하나가 문제일 수 있으니, 각각의 경우에 대한 대처 방법을 시도해 보시기 바랍니다. 만약에 이러한 대처 방법을 시도해 봐도 문제가 해결되지 않는다면, 추가적인 정보가 필요할 수 있습니다.


    만족스러운 답변이었나요?간단한 별점을 통해 의견을 알려주세요.